The pianist and composer Holman Alvarez was born in Barranquilla and raised in Cali - Colombia. He enjoys finding connections between things. This kind of thinking has allowed him to use in his music ideas coming from several influences: Colombian and Latin American music, Jazz, classic and contemporary music, salsa, and free improvisation.He studied piano and composition at Universidad del Valle in Cali and his magister in composition at Universidad Javeriana in Bogotá-Colombia. He also studied piano-jazz at the Conservatorio Manuel de Falla in Buenos Aires Argentina.In the years he lived in Bogotá (2011-2022), he recorded five albums as a leader and several others as a sideman. He became part of the group of improvisers who played regularly in Matik-Matik, the iconic bar in Bogotá that allowed all kinds of experimentation. In those years he worked as an assistant professor at Universidad Javeriana.As a sideman pianist, he performed with renowned national musicians like Antonio Arnedo, Jorge Sepúlveda, Lucía Pulido, and Gina Savino; as well as international musicians who have visited Colombia, like Victor Mendoza, Antonio Sanchez, and Guillermo Klein, among others.As a composer, he has written for several formats and genres including commissions for classical musicians, Jazz ensembles, and audiovisual media from 2004 until now. In 2018 he was nominated for best song at the Macondo Film Awards in Bogotá-Colombia. In 2024 his song called He ganado y he perdido was featured in the film El Canto del Auricanturi by Camila Rodriguez Triana.His interest in other art forms had him taken to work with writers, curators, and visual artists, collaborating on projects as Hegelian Dancers with the art collective Fleshy School at the Arts Academy of China in Hangzhou in 2019.In October 2023 he released the album LIMINAL along with Colombian musicians Kike Harker and Ramón Berrocal. The album received an award granted by the Colombian Ministry of Culture.In November 2024 Sunnyside Records will release his new album called Hidden Objects along with NY-based musicians Adam O'Farril, Drew Gress, and Satoshi Takeishi.Since 2022 he has been playing actively in the NYC scene along with musicians John Benitez, Sean Conly, Billy Mintz, Michael Veal, Rachel Therrien among others.
